Hotel Gardenia

A short drive from central Verona, Hotel Gardenia is spread across two connected buildings. The spacious guest rooms are air-conditioned and come with a TV, minibar and free WiFi. Elsewhere in the hotel, an extensive breakfast is served daily. There’s a bus stop a few minutes’ walk away that offers easy access to the town centre as well as Verona’s railway station. Verona Villafranca Airport is 20 minutes away by road.

Hotel Porta Palio

This charming Verona hotel combines a great location with plenty of appealing features, including a bar and a garden area. Soundproofed guest rooms are air-conditioned and come with a flat-screen TV and a private bathroom with free toiletries, and some rooms also overlook a pretty canal. There’s a popular on-site Trattoria-style restaurant serving classic Verona dishes. Those arriving by car can make use of either a free outdoor car park or an underground garage for an extra charge. The hotel is a 15-minute walk from Verona Porta Nuova Train Station and there’s also a free shuttle service to and from the town centre.

Hotel Piccolo

Situated in one of Verona’s most peaceful enclaves, this quaint 3-star hotel is a popular choice with those on a budget. Guest rooms are decorated in contemporary style and each comes with natural wood furniture, a private bathroom, a minibar, an LCD TV and free WiFi. A buffet style breakfast is served each morning and there are also vending machines, a gymnasium, and 24-hour reception. Bike rentals and a sauna and massages are all available for an extra charge too. The hotel puts on free shuttle services to Verona Arena, where regular opera shows are staged.
